A law firm located in Cincinnati, OH, is currently seeking a skilled Patent Litigation Associate Attorney to join their team. The ideal candidate should possess second or third chair experience in patent litigation and preferably hold a Bachelor's degree in electrical engineering. This role offers an exciting opportunity to work on challenging patent litigation cases and requires a minimum of 4 years of relevant experience in the field.

 

Duties:

  • Assist in managing patent litigation cases from inception to resolution.
  • Draft and respond to motions, pleadings, and other legal documents related to patent litigation matters.
  • Conduct comprehensive legal research and analysis on patent law issues, including infringement and validity analyses.
  • Collaborate closely with senior attorneys to develop effective case strategies and tactics.
  • Participate in all phases of discovery, including document review, drafting discovery requests, and preparing for depositions.
  • Prepare for and participate in hearings, trials, and other court proceedings as required.
  • Maintain regular communication with clients, opposing counsel, and internal team members.
  • Organize and manage case files and documentation efficiently.

 

Requirements:

  • Juris Doctor (.) degree from an accredited law school.
  • Admission to the Ohio State Bar; additional state bar admissions are advantageous.
  • Minimum of 4 years of experience working on patent litigation cases in a law firm environment.
  • Second or third chair experience in patent litigation is highly desirable.
  • Bachelor's degree in electrical engineering or a related field preferred.
  • Strong understanding of patent law principles, procedures, and USPTO regulations.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to work both independ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ced legal environment.
